How can I upload files, like a picture of a book or a film, without violate the copyright rights? Thanks, Alcacer1 (talk) 19:44, 27 December 2008 (UTC)

Hello,
Book covers, Cd covers, posters are all protected by copyrights. The only way to upload them on commons is to get permission from the original author or rights holder. That permission should be send to OTRS. When the receive the permission the will try to verify it and you will get a respond with a ticket number. When you place the ticket number on the image description page it will be fine.
Now I know its kind of hard to get the permission under a free license and most of the time you will not even get permission.
There is a other way, Some Wikis use a Fair use policy, Those project are listed here. On those project you can upload the image locally without any problems, and without copyvio. So please check of your project is listed there, and upload it locally or try to get permission.
